Python数学建模算法与应用:解锁科学计算的无限可能
Mathematical_Modeling-master.zip项目地址:https://gitcode.com/open-source-toolkit/db2c8
在当今数据驱动的世界中,数学建模与计算机技术的结合已成为推动科技创新的核心动力。如果您是一名热衷于科学计算、数据分析或机器学习的研究者或开发者,那么这个开源项目——Python数学建模算法与应用源码,将是您不可或缺的工具。
项目介绍
本项目是一个专注于数学建模算法的Python源码集合,旨在帮助用户深入理解和应用各种数学建模技术。无论您是学术研究者、教育工作者,还是行业从业者,这些源码都将为您提供强大的支持,助您在实际问题中找到最优解决方案。
项目技术分析
本仓库涵盖了多种经典的数学建模算法与模型,包括但不限于:
- 线性规划:适用于资源最优配置问题,广泛应用于生产计划、投资分析等领域。
- 排队论模型:帮助理解服务系统效率,优化交通流管理、客户服务等待时间等。
- 微分方程建模:用于探讨系统的动态变化,是生物学、物理学等科学研究的核心工具。
- 时间序列模型:在金融分析、气象预测中不可或缺,帮助掌握数据随时间的变化趋势。
- 支持向量机(SVM):强大的分类与回归工具,广泛应用于机器学习领域。
- 预测方法:集合多种策略,帮助进行未来的精准预测,无论是市场走向还是自然现象。
- 层次分析法(AHP):解决多准则下的决策问题,适用于项目评估、偏好排序等复杂情景。
这些算法不仅具有高度的实用性,而且每种算法都附有详细的注释,便于用户理解和学习。
项目及技术应用场景
本项目的应用场景非常广泛,涵盖了多个学科和行业:
- 学术研究:为研究人员提供现成的算法实现,加速科研进程。
- 教育培训:适合作为教学资源,帮助学生更好地理解数学建模的概念与应用。
- 工业应用:在生产计划、资源配置、服务优化等领域提供技术支持。
- 金融分析:通过时间序列模型和支持向量机等技术,进行市场预测和风险评估。
- 科学研究:利用微分方程建模等技术,探讨系统的动态变化,推动科学进步。
项目特点
- 实用性:所有代码均经过验证,可直接应用于实际问题。
- 教育性:每种算法都有简明的注释,适合学术研究和教学。
- 可扩展性:鼓励用户基于现有模型进行二次开发,探索新的应用方向。
- 跨学科:覆盖了从基础数学到现代计算科学的多个层面,促进知识的交叉融合。
使用指南
- 克隆或下载本仓库至本地。
- 确保您的Python环境已安装必要的库(如NumPy, SciPy, Sklearn等)。
- 阅读各脚本中的说明文档,了解如何运行和调整参数。
- 实验、探索,并在需要时贡献您的改进建议或新模块。
致社区
我们诚挚邀请每一位对数学建模与Python编程有热情的朋友加入我们的社区。无论是提出问题、报告bug、请求新功能还是提交代码,您的参与都将为这个项目增添无限价值。让我们共同努力,将这个资源打造成一个更加丰富、更加强大的学习与创新平台。
开始您的数学建模之旅,用代码解锁知识的力量,解决现实生活中的挑战!
请合理使用本仓库的资源,尊重开源精神,遵守相应的版权及许可规范,共同维护良好的技术共享氛围。
Mathematical_Modeling-master.zip项目地址:https://gitcode.com/open-source-toolkit/db2c8